    WHAT YOU WILL DO

    • Deliver value to the organization by ensuring uninterrupted flow of services and materials through effective communication
    • Provide responsive and effective support to team on project status with parts and materials
    • Comply with and uphold procurement guidelines and standard procedures
    • Responsible for project-specific order management, including (but not limited to) processing purchase orders, updating pricing, ETA's and delivery confirmation
    • Responsible for building and maintaining positive relationships with Laurel Ag & Water vendors
    • Provide Director of Procurement and Purchasing Manager cost analysis on like items from different vendors
    • Works cross functionally with other departments to forecast the needs of the business and make purchase decisions based on demand
